Counselor Decisions, system of records notice and removing it from its inventory. The DOI Ethics Office maintains records on employee public financial disclosure reports, financial interest statements, conflict of interest decisions, and other records to administer the DOI Ethics Program and ensure compliance with ethics laws and regulations. During a review of the INTERIOR/DOI03 notice, DOI
determined that these records are covered under two Government-wide system of records notices published by OGE: OGE/GOVT1, Executive Branch Personnel Public Financial Disclosure Reports and Other Name-Retrieved Ethics Program Records, 84 FR 47303
September 9, 2019; and OGE/GOVT2, Executive Branch Confidential Financial Disclosure Reports, 84 FR 47301
September 9, 2019.
A Government-wide system of records is a system of records where one agency has regulatory authority over the records in the custody of multiple agencies and that agency has the responsibility for publishing a system of records notice that applies to all of the records regardless of their custodial location.
The two OGE government-wide system of records notices apply to the records maintained by the DOI Ethics Program pursuant to ethics laws and regulations.
Therefore, DOI is rescinding the INTERIOR/DOI03, Financial Interest Statements and Ethics Counselor Decisions, system of records notice to eliminate an unnecessary duplicate notice in accordance with the Office of Management and Budget Circular A108, Federal Agency Responsibilities for Review, Reporting, and Publication under the Privacy Act.
Rescinding the INTERIOR/DOI03, Financial Interest Statements and Ethics Counselor Decisions, system of records notice will have no adverse impacts on individuals as the records are covered by OGE/GOVT1, Executive Branch Personnel Public Financial Disclosure Reports and Other Name-Retrieved Ethics Program Records, and OGE/
GOVT2, Executive Branch Confidential Financial Disclosure Reports, which apply to the records regardless of their custodial location. This rescindment will also promote the overall streamlining and management of DOI
